Transaction 5ae264b5039e392353b4b312a4f5573af66fdee2e2b9c0636eb66f191ed18c91
1 Input
1 Output
-
5ae264b5039e392353b4b312a4f5573af66fdee2e2b9c0636eb66f191ed18c91:0
- value
- 653882
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90a3eb3a95887813fde37efa93efc96efaec7b27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EBnfuYCcRYbYshL8jfbxWcsqT3pFHTAKU